1. In the V Model, what is the primary purpose of the verification phase?

Explanation

In the V Model, the verification phase focuses on confirming that the outputs from each development stage align with the defined requirements. This ensures that the product is built correctly at each step, minimizing errors and enhancing quality before moving on to subsequent phases.

2. Which testing level in the V Model occurs immediately after unit development?

Explanation

Integration testing occurs immediately after unit development in the V Model. This level focuses on combining individual units and testing them as a group to identify interface defects and ensure that the integrated components work together correctly, bridging the gap between unit testing and system testing.

3. What is the main difference between verification and validation in the V Model?

Explanation

Verification involves assessing whether the product meets specified requirements and is built correctly, focusing on the process and outputs. In contrast, validation ensures that the product fulfills its intended purpose and meets user needs, emphasizing the alignment with real-world requirements. This distinction highlights the different objectives of each activity within the V Model.

4. In the V Model, unit testing verifies the correctness of individual ____.

Explanation

Unit testing focuses on validating the smallest testable parts of an application, known as code units, such as functions or methods. By isolating these components, developers can ensure that each unit performs as expected, which is crucial for building reliable software. This testing phase is integral to identifying bugs early in the development process.

6. Which phase of the V Model corresponds with acceptance testing on the verification side?

Explanation

In the V Model, the requirements analysis phase corresponds with acceptance testing because it establishes the criteria for what the system must achieve. This phase ensures that all user needs are documented and understood, guiding the development process and aligning testing with the defined requirements to validate that the final product meets user expectations.

7. What is the purpose of integration testing in the V Model verification phase?

Explanation

Integration testing in the V Model verification phase ensures that different components of a system interact as intended. This phase focuses on detecting interface defects and ensuring that combined functionalities perform correctly, which is crucial before moving on to system testing and validation against user requirements.

10. Which of the following is NOT a typical verification activity in the V Model?

Explanation

Customer deployment is not a verification activity in the V Model; it occurs after the verification and validation phases. Verification activities, such as code review, unit testing, and system testing, focus on ensuring that the product meets specified requirements before it is delivered to the customer.

12. The V Model verification phase emphasizes early ____ to catch defects sooner.

Explanation

The V Model emphasizes early testing to identify and address defects at the earliest stages of development. By incorporating testing activities alongside each development phase, it ensures that issues are detected and resolved promptly, leading to higher quality outcomes and reduced costs associated with later-stage defect resolution.
